Transaction 51831f8dcebd5a637b3427e4ab290462c09659c6b2910f41c5ef3b15c138de7f

1 Input
2 Outputs
  • 51831f8dcebd5a637b3427e4ab290462c09659c6b2910f41c5ef3b15c138de7f:0
  • value  4183250696
    address  2MtXLQH55B5MFutnQDjvLw1Er3aoc4A4dsr
  • 51831f8dcebd5a637b3427e4ab290462c09659c6b2910f41c5ef3b15c138de7f:1
  • value  1341749
    address  2NCgS78c7fULZuZJSThgN5PdajhMBvtZDtV